Types of Scientific Angler WF 12/13 Fly Lines
Scientific Angler offers several specialized WF (Weight Forward) 12/13 fly lines, each tailored for different fishing scenarios:
1. Saltwater Lines – Built for durability in corrosive environments.
2. Coldwater Lines – Designed for optimal performance in low temperatures.
3. Tropical Lines – Heat-resistant for warm-water fishing.
4. Specialty Taper Lines – Enhanced for distance casting or delicate presentations.
—
How to Choose the Best Scientific Angler WF 12/13 Fly Line
Selecting the right line depends on:
✅ Fishing Environment – Saltwater, freshwater, tropical, or coldwater?
✅ Casting Style – Do you need distance, accuracy, or quick-loading performance?
✅ Fly Size & Weight – Heavier flies require stronger tapers.
✅ Water Temperature – Some lines perform better in extreme conditions.

FAQ: Common Questions About Scientific Angler WF 12/13 Fly Lines
Q1: Can I use a WF 12/13 line on a 10-weight rod?
A: Not recommended—overloading your rod can damage it and reduce casting efficiency.
Q2: How often should I replace my fly line?
A: With proper care, a high-quality line can last 2-3 seasons. Clean regularly to extend lifespan.
Q3: Are textured lines better than smooth ones?
A: Textured lines reduce friction for longer casts, but smooth lines are quieter for stealth.
Q4: What’s the best line for cold weather?
A: The Mastery Coldwater series is designed to stay supple in freezing temps.
Q5: Can I use a saltwater line in freshwater?
A: Yes, but freshwater-specific lines may perform better in certain conditions.
